Speaking as a Floridiot...
[info]redina
2004-03-16 06:47 am UTC (link)
I'm surprised they didn't try scheduling it on Disney World's Gay Pride Day. {chuckle} I suspect the PR junkets for POA would've blessedly prevented that.

Travelodge? First [and only] time I attended an actor/fan meeting was the last Weekend on the Promenade, a gathering of actor fanclubs. I believe the convention was held at the Burbank Hilton... Heh, and apparently, a group of Abe Lincoln impersonators was there too. They certainly surprised me. {g}

As to this event occurring at the end of July, I'm guessing they've been advised by at least one Floridian, Heidi of FA. If you're lucky, the temperatures may be between 84^F-88^F. If you're unlucky, it'll be raining (summer rains) *and* between 84^F-88^F, which makes it feel like 95^F-100^F from humidity.

Hm, toasty.

Sorry, I just don't see this happening. As someone pointed out, actors/actresses may do things for charity but not just for a random fan gathering that'll probably be small. There's always the possibility for exceptions but they're rare and far between.

If they could make it a charity event and bump up the admission prices (money going to a charity *and* can prove it'll go to a charity), then the chances might be better. Charge for such things like signings and ask WB's TPTB if they might consider donating items for a charity auction (even such things like posters and promo items). Do a bit of research and see what charities the actors/actresses had favoured in the past.

Unfortunately, the HP fandom deals with many who can't afford this. Every time I had attended slash conventions like Escapade (http://www.escapadecon.net - note the attendance fees are at least $65-75 which is close to the 'average' for slash cons), most of the attendees were over twenty-five... Yet, this con always sells out and has to form a 'wait list'.

Sure, fans can form a gathering but getting the actors... {shakes head} I wouldn't bet on it.

Not wanky... just poorly planned.
